Infimobile via Amazon has for New Infinimobile Customers: 12-Month Infimobile Prepaid Unlimited Talk & Text + 15GB Data Mobile Phone Plan SIM Card Kit on sale for $150 - 25% off when you clip the coupon listed on the product page = $112.50 (equivalent to $9.38/month). Shipping is free.

Thanks to Community Member dragoneater1 for finding this deal.
  • Note: You must be logged in to clip coupons; coupons are typically for one-time use.
Available options:About this Plan:
  • 15GB of 5G / 4G LTE data per month
    • If your 15GB allotment of high speed 5G/4G LTE data is consumed before the end of a 30 day cycle, data is unlimited but will be reduced to slower speeds for the remainder of that month.
  • Unlimited Nationwide Talk & Text
  • Wi-Fi Calling & Texts
  • Hotspot available for purchase as an add-on via your Infinimobile account
